Top App Developers: Individual vs Team Options 2024

The views expressed in this post are the writer's and do not necessarily reflect the views of Aloa or AloaLabs, LLC.

App development is a critical aspect of any business's digital transformation journey. The choice of top app developers can make or break your project, and this decision often boils down to an essential comparison: individual developers versus dedicated teams. Making the right choice can be daunting, but it's crucial for the success of your software solutions.

Aloa, an expert in software outsourcing, helps businesses and startups navigate these challenges. With a focus on delivering top app developers, Aloa connects clients with the best project talent. They understand the nuances of app development, mobile apps, web development, and custom software solutions. Aloa's dedicated teams bring unparalleled expertise, ensuring the highest quality assurance, user experience, and project management.

This blog will delve into the top app development companies. We'll also compare the benefits of choosing individual developers or development teams based on various factors such as project complexity, budget, and development time. Afterward, you'll have a clear roadmap to select the right app development company for your unique needs, ensuring a great app, high user engagement, and a successful digital presence.

Let's dive in!

Top App Developers 2024: 5 Options to Explore

In app development, choosing the right developers can make all the difference. As we enter 2024, the demand for top app developers continues to rise. To help you navigate this dynamic landscape, we've curated a list of the top 5 app development companies poised to shine in the coming year.

Let's explore the top app developers of 2024, each offering unparalleled expertise and a track record of delivering outstanding digital solutions.

1. Aloa - Best Site to Hire Top App Developers

Aloa - Best Site to Hire Top App Developers

Aloa stands out among top app developers for its focus on simplifying the outsourcing process in software development. They handle all aspects of outsourcing, from vetting developers to managing international payments, offering a streamlined experience that saves clients time and money. Aloa's involvement in over 250 client projects showcases its substantial presence in app development​​​​.

Aloa partner network, where each agency undergoes a rigorous vetting process, ensuring a less than 1% acceptance rate. This meticulous selection guarantees that clients are paired with the highest-quality developers. Aloa's platform is designed for outsourcing, providing tools and processes that facilitate smooth project management regardless of existing procedures​​.

Their expertise in mobile app development and a commitment to staying current with programming languages and market trends make them a top choice for companies looking to make a significant impact in the US market and beyond.

Notable Features of Working with Aloa

  • Aloa Data-Backed Insights: Aloa provides transparent and predictable progress reports every two weeks, aiding in informed decision-making throughout the project​​.
  • Rigorous Vetting Process: The Aloa Partner Network boasts a less than 1% acceptance rate, ensuring that only the best developers are paired with clients​​.
  • End-to-End Project Management: Aloa's platform is designed for outsourcing, accommodating existing processes and new setups for seamless project management​​.
  • Agile Development Process: Aloa's agile methodology emphasizes flexibility and efficiency, adapting to changing project requirements and effectively delivering results.
  • Custom App Development: They cater to unique client needs, likely offering bespoke solutions tailored to specific business goals and challenges.
  • Cross-Platform App Development: Aloa likely provides development services across multiple platforms, ensuring broad compatibility and reach for client applications.

Aloa Pricing Plans

Aloa offers tailored pricing plans to suit various business models. While specific details aren't available on their website, their flexible approach likely includes project-based, dedicated team, and staff augmentation options, catering to early-stage startups, enterprises, and businesses needing quick scaling or additional support​​​​​​​​.

Businesses that would benefit most from Aloa's services include startups needing MVPs, enterprises requiring staff augmentation, and any organization seeking efficient, high-quality app development. Their target audience spans those needing custom software development, web apps, and digital marketing solutions, emphasizing the importance of a professional team and user interface in app design.

2. Naked Development - Best for Innovative Mobile App Development

Naked Development - Best for Innovative Mobile App Development

Naked Development distinguishes itself as one of the top app developers, particularly in mobile app development. Situated in Irvine, California, their approach combines strategy, creativity, and technology. They view clients as partners, ensuring a collaborative development process.

Naked Development offers a full-service offering encompassing strategy, creativity, technology, and a partnership approach. They have successfully generated billions in-app revenue, produced millions of app downloads, and raised substantial venture capital for clients. Their exclusively US-based team sets them apart from top mobile app development companies.

Notable Features of Working with Naked Development

  • Innovative Design: They emphasize creative and user-friendly designs, making their apps stand out.
  • Intuitive Programming: Their software development team employs the latest technologies for efficient and effective programming.
  • Comprehensive Services: Offering design, development, marketing, and fundraising, they are like an incubator and accelerator combined.
  • Strategic Partnership: They treat clients as partners, emphasizing collaboration throughout development.

Naked Development Pricing Plans

Their services are priced between $100 and $149 per hour, with a team size of 10 to 49 professionals. This range indicates flexibility in handling various project sizes.

Businesses beginning a new venture, particularly those seeking a comprehensive service from design to fundraising, will benefit significantly from Naked Development's approach. Their target audience includes startups and companies in the United States, particularly in tech hubs like Los Angeles, New York, and San Francisco.

3. Mercury Development - Best for Comprehensive Mobile App Development

Mercury Development - Best for Comprehensive Mobile App Development

With over 20 years in the industry, Mercury Development stands out as one of the top app developers for its extensive experience creating over 1500 iOS and Android mobile apps. Their expertise in optimizing native and hybrid apps to meet the latest technological standards has led to their services being utilized by more than 40 million users. This reputation cements them as a leading choice for mobile app development services​​.

Mercury Development app development begins with a detailed scope definition, ensuring each project is started with clear and prioritized requirements. Their distinctive process in analysis and design, involving user flow establishment and wireframe layouts, further sets them apart. This systematic approach is rare, even among the best app development companies​​​​.

Notable Features of Working with Mercury Development

  • Sprint-Based Development Approach: Offers excellent visibility and control over project scope​​.
  • Thorough Quality Assurance: Involves functional, exploratory, and, where applicable, automated testing​​.
  • Deployment Support: Assistance in app deployment and submission, with ongoing support options​​.
  • Expertise in iOS and Android Apps: Ensures delivery of visually stunning and user-friendly applications​​.

Mercury Development Pricing Plans

Mercury Development does not explicitly list its pricing plans on the website. Their app development costs vary based on project complexity, features, and client needs.

Businesses seeking high-quality, user-focused mobile applications, especially those requiring iOS and Android compatibility, will benefit significantly from Mercury Development's expertise. Their ability to cater to a diverse user base makes them an ideal choice for companies targeting a broad audience, including those needing high-performance and scalable solutions on various devices, including tablets​​.

4. Intent - Best for IoT-Integrated App Development

Intent - Best for IoT-Integrated App Development

Intent is among the top app developers specializing in IoT-integrated mobile app development. They provide comprehensive services for both iOS and Android platforms, advising clients on the most efficient technological stacks. This expertise positions them as a leading software development company for projects intersecting mobile application development with IoT needs​​.

Intent is extensively involved in firmware and embedded systems for IoT devices. This unique blend of software and hardware expertise, ensuring optimal performance and reliability, is a distinguishing feature not commonly found in most app development agencies​​.

Notable Features of Working with Intent

  • In-depth Web Development: Full-stack team capable of creating or updating web applications to meet client visions​​.
  • Product Validation: Emphasis on verifying product quality, functionality, and usability with potential users​​.
  • User Experience (UX) Design: Expertise in creating user-centric designs, mapping user journeys, and defining user flow​​.
  • UI Design: Development of visually appealing designs that align with brand identity​​.

Intent Pricing Plans

Intent's website does not provide specific details regarding pricing plans. Their pricing is tailored to the scope and specifics of each project.

Businesses looking to integrate mobile applications with IoT products would find Intent's services highly beneficial. Their proficiency in mobile app and firmware development for various devices, combined with their focus on user experience and interface design, makes them ideal for clients seeking a comprehensive digital solution beyond traditional app development.

5. CodigoDelSur - Best for Versatile and Innovative App Development

CodigoDelSur - Best for Versatile and Innovative App Development

CodigoDelSur has been a significant player among top app developers since 2007, crafting mobile applications across various sectors like healthcare, e-commerce, education, and even drone technology. They excel in iOS (using Swift & SwiftUI) and Android (using Kotlin & Jetpack Compose) development, alongside proficiency in cross-platform development with React Native and Flutter. This wide-ranging expertise marks them as a leading mobile app development agency.

They can merge app development with cutting-edge technology like drones, augmented reality, virtual reality, and IoT. Their willingness to engage in innovative and groundbreaking projects positions them uniquely among app development agencies, especially for clients looking to venture into the future of technology​​.

Notable Features of Working with CodigoDelSur

  • Web Development Expertise: Can build sophisticated web applications using React.js, Angular.js, Vue.js, Node.js, Python, and Ruby on Rails​​.
  • Staff Augmentation Services: Provides the right talent with the needed skill set and seniority to enhance in-house development teams​​.
  • UI/UX Design: Focuses on delivering aesthetically appealing and user-friendly digital products​​.
  • Quality Assurance: Ensures high-quality digital products through manual and automated testing​​.

CodigoDelSur Pricing Plans

CodigoDelSur's website does not specify pricing plans. They offer a project-specific approach to pricing.

Businesses seeking innovative, technology-forward mobile app solutions, especially those interested in integrating their apps with advanced technologies like AR, VR, IoT, and drones, will find CodigoDelSur's services exceptionally beneficial. Their comprehensive approach, encompassing app development, web development, UI/UX design, and quality assurance, caters to a wide range of digital product needs.

Benefits of Individual vs. Team App Development

When developing a top-notch mobile app, one of the crucial decisions you need to make is whether to hire individual app developers or opt for a dedicated team. Each option comes with its own set of advantages and disadvantages.

Let's delve into the benefits of individual app developers versus app development teams, providing a comprehensive comparison to help you make an informed choice.

Benefits of Individual vs. Team App Development

Expertise and Skillset

  • Individual App Developers: Individual developers often specialize in specific areas, which can be advantageous for niche projects. They understand their chosen technology stack deeply and can offer specialized expertise.
  • App Development Teams: Development teams comprise individuals with diverse skill sets. This diversity allows for a broader range of skills and experiences, making tackling complex projects requiring multiple areas of expertise easier.

Project Complexity and Scalability

  • Individual App Developers: For relatively simple projects with a limited scope, hiring an individual developer can be cost-effective and efficient. However, individual developers may need help with larger, more complex projects that require extensive resources and coordination.
  • App Development Teams: Development teams are well-suited for complex projects because they can scale resources as needed. Whether your project grows in scope or encounters unforeseen challenges, teams can adapt more efficiently, ensuring project success.

Communication and Collaboration

  • Individual App Developers: Working with an individual developer can lead to more direct communication and faster decision-making. However, effective collaboration may be limited, notably if the developer needs to gain experience in project management.
  • App Development Teams: Development teams have established communication structures and project management processes. They excel at collaboration, ensuring that team members work seamlessly together, share ideas, and solve problems efficiently.

Project Timelines and Deadlines

  • Individual App Developers: Individual developers may need help to meet tight deadlines independently, especially if they encounter unexpected issues or need additional support. Timelines may be more flexible but less predictable.
  • App Development Teams: Teams are better equipped to meet project deadlines consistently. They can distribute tasks, allocate resources, and implement efficient workflows to ensure timely project delivery.


  • Individual App Developers: Hiring an individual developer can be cost-effective for small projects with a limited budget. However, for larger projects requiring diverse skills, the cumulative cost of hiring multiple individuals may outweigh the benefits.
  • App Development Teams: While development teams may have a higher initial cost, they often provide better long-term value for complex projects. The diverse skill set and efficient collaboration can lead to a more cost-effective solution.

How To Choose the Top App Developers for Your Project

Having a mobile app for your business or idea is essential. Whether you're looking to create a mobile game, a productivity tool, or an e-commerce platform, you need top app developers to bring your vision to life.

Let's explore the step-by-step process of selecting the top app developers for your project.

How To Choose the Top App Developers for Your Project

Step 1: Define Your Project Requirements

Before you start your search for top app developers, you need to have a clear understanding of your project's requirements. Consider asking yourself these questions:

  • What is the purpose of your app?
  • Who is your target audience?
  • What platforms (iOS, Android, or both) do you want to target?
  • Do you have specific features or functionalities in mind?

Defining your project requirements is the foundation of your app development journey. It sets the direction and scope for your project and ensures that you and your chosen developers are on the same page. To create an intense project brief, Take the time to define your goals, target audience, and desired features.

Step 2: Research Top App Developers

Once you have a clear project brief, it's time to research the best app developers specializing in your project's niche. You can begin your search by:

Research Top App Developers
  • Online Search: Use search engines and app development directories to find potential candidates.
  • Ask for Recommendations: Contact your network, industry peers, or online communities. Personal referrals can be valuable in finding trustworthy developers.
  • App Store Research: Explore the app stores to find apps similar to your project. Check the app credits or contact the developers if their work aligns with your vision.
  • Review Portfolios and Case Studies: Visit the websites and portfolios of potential developers to assess their past projects, expertise, and client reviews.

Researching the best app developers is critical in finding the right team for your project. You can identify potential candidates by using online resources, seeking recommendations, exploring past work, and even considering vetting playbooks like Aloa's.

Aloa's vetting playbook, in particular, provides valuable insights and criteria for evaluating app developers, making your selection process even more robust. Remember that a comprehensive research phase increases your chances of selecting the most suitable developers.

Step 3: Evaluate Their Expertise

Now that you have a list of potential app developers, it's time to evaluate their expertise. Here are some key factors to consider:

Evaluate Their Expertise
  • Technical Skills: Ensure that the developers have the technical skills necessary for your project, whether native app development, cross-platform development, or specialized skills like augmented reality (AR) or machine learning.
  • Industry Experience: Check if the developers have experience in your industry or niche. Industry-specific knowledge can be invaluable for creating a successful app.
  • Previous Work: Review their past projects and apps. Pay attention to design aesthetics, user experience, and overall quality. This will give you a sense of their capabilities.
  • Team Composition: Consider the size and composition of the development team. A well-rounded team with designers, developers, and quality assurance specialists can ensure a more comprehensive approach to your project.

Evaluating the expertise of your potential app developers is essential to ensure they can meet your project's technical and industry-specific requirements. Pay close attention to their technical skills, industry experience, and past work to make an informed decision. A well-rounded team can make a significant difference in the quality of your app.

Step 4: Check References and Reviews

Contact their previous clients for references to validate further the credibility of the best app developers you're considering. Ask for contact information and conduct interviews or send questionnaires to gather insights into their working relationships and project outcomes.

Checking references and reading reviews provides valuable insights into the reputation and client satisfaction of the top app developers you are considering. This can help you better understand their work ethics and professionalism. Reach out to previous clients and read online reviews to make an informed choice.

Step 5: Discuss Budget and Timeline

Once you've narrowed your list of potential best app developers, it's time to discuss budget and timeline. Schedule meetings or consultations with each candidate to:

Discuss Budget and Timeline
  • Request Quotes: Ask for detailed project quotes, including development costs, maintenance fees, and additional expenses. Make sure there are no hidden costs.
  • Discuss Timelines: Clarify the project timeline, including milestones and deadlines. Ensure that the developers can meet your project's time constraints.
  • Payment Structure: Understand the payment structure. Some developers may require upfront payments, while others may work on milestone-based payments or hourly rates.
  • Contract Terms: Review the contract terms and legal agreements carefully. Ensure the contract covers project scope, intellectual property rights, and dispute resolution procedures.

Discussing the budget and timeline with your chosen app developers is the final step before deciding. It's crucial to have transparent communication regarding costs, payment structures, project timelines, and contract terms. This will ensure that you and the developers are on the same page and that there are no surprises along the way.

Key Takeaway

Choosing the right app developers is crucial for project success. The decision between individual developers and top app developers as teams can significantly impact the outcome of your project. Making well-informed decisions tailored to your needs and project requirements is crucial.

By opting for the best app developers, you gain access to expertise, collective knowledge, and diverse skill sets that can elevate your project to new heights. These teams bring efficiency, scalability, and a structured approach to development, ensuring that your app meets the highest standards.

To ensure a successful partnership with top app developers, thoroughly assess your project requirements, budget, and complexity. Conduct interviews, perform due diligence, and don't hesitate to contact experienced teams like those at Aloa. Contact us at [email protected] for expert guidance on your app development journey. Choose wisely, and your app will thrive in the competitive digital landscape.

Aloa is your trusted software development partner.

Hire your team
Innovate freely ✌️
See why 300+ startups & enterprises trust Aloa with their software outsourcing.
Let's chatLet's chat

Ready to learn more? 
Hire software developers today.

Running a business is hard,
Software development shouldn't be ✌️